| Only so-so design. Yes they do hold bullets and feed well, but they arent too friendly to stripper clip loaders. Since they dont use the same floorplate design as a g.i. M4 magazine they wont accept ranger plates, magpuls, etc. The floorplate slides over the sides of the magazine (just like glock mags), so they are wider than normal-so they wont stack correctly in magazine pouches that are full height. Spend the extra $3 and get mil-spec. |
